Frequently Asked Questions about Milford

How much are Studio apartments in Milford?

There are currently 35 Studio Apartments in Milford with rent ranges from $1,250 to $2,475 with an average price of $1,978.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Milford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Milford ranges from $1,450 to $2,992 with an average monthly rent of $2,399.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Milford c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Milford range from $1,800 to $3,806.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,922.
